TODDLER MITTEN PATTERN
IN SPORTS WEIGHT YARN

When my grand nephew James turned one year old he needed mittens that were light weight plus had thumbs. The only patterns I could find were either in sports weight but NO thumbs, or with thumbs but in knitting worsted weight. I wanted to make him mittens in sports weight AND with thumbs so made my own patterns.
Materials
Gauge: 24 sts to 4 inches The finished mitten is 2 3/4 inches wide and as long as your child's hand.
- 50 gm sport weight yarn (enough for 2 pairs)
- 3.75 mm (US #5) dpn's
- small stitch holder or a safety pin
Cast on 32 sts and divide on the dpn's as 12 sts, 8 sts, 12 sts on the three needles. Join, being careful not to twist the sts.
Work in K2, P2 ribbing for 10 rows for the cuff.
Next Row: (Decrease Row) * K2tog. Repeat from * to end. (16 sts.)
Work K1, P1 ribbing for 5 rows.
Next Row: Increase in each stitch (32 sts).
Work in st st for 6 rows.
Next Row: Knit across 4 sts, put the next 4 sts on the holder. Cast on 4 sts and continue to knit around.
Continue in st st until desired length, roughly the tip of the baby finger.
Row 1: * K6, K2 tog *. Repeat * to * to the end (28 sts).
Row 2: Knit around.
Row 3: * K5, K2 tog *. Repeat * to * to the end (24 sts).
Row 4: * K4, K2 tog *. Repeat * to * to the end (20 sts).
Row 5: * K3, K2 tog *. Repeat * to * to the end (16 sts).
Row 6: * K2, K2 tog *. Repeat * to * to the end (12 sts).
Row 7: * K1, K2 tog *. Repeat * to * to the end (8 sts).Fasten off leaving an 8 inch tail. Thread through the sts, pull tight, and close the top.
THUMB
Slip the 4 sts from the hold, pick up 6 sts around the opening (10 sts).
Knit 7 rows or the desired length.
Decrease to 5 sts by K2tog around.
Fasten off leaving an 8 inch tail. Thread through the sts, pull tight, and close the top.
Make the 2nd mitten in the same way.
